Understanding the Listed Transactions Update and Refresher

The Listed Transactions Update is crucial for tax compliance, primarily addressing the IRS's definition and implications of Listed Transactions. Tax professionals and individuals involved with certain benefit plans must understand these transactions to ensure they meet compliance requirements. This update references the 2008 San Diego Tax & Accounting Institute presentation, which elaborates on specific benefit plans such as IRC § 412(i) fully insured Defined Benefit Plans, IRC § 419A(f)(6) Welfare Plans, and IRC § 419(e) welfare plans, highlighting their significance in tax compliance.

Why You Need the Listed Transactions Update and Refresher

Understanding the Listed Transactions Update is vital for maintaining compliance with IRS regulations. Form 8886 plays a key role in reporting listed transactions to the IRS, and failure to comply can result in substantial penalties and tax issues. Staying informed about updates from the IRS helps individuals and tax professionals mitigate risks associated with non-compliance.
